Competition Overview

  • Australian Mathematics Competition

    The Australian Mathematics Competition (AMC) is the flagship mathematics competition of the Australian Maths Trust. First held in 1978, it is Australia’s longest-running and best-known school mathematics competition, engaging primary and secondary students in Australia and internationally.


    Each year, the AMC presents a new set of problems developed by experienced mathematicians and educators. The questions are designed to assess more than routine calculation: students must interpret information, recognise patterns, select appropriate strategies and apply mathematical ideas in unfamiliar situations.


    The competition is offered across five official divisions—Middle Primary, Upper Primary, Junior, Intermediate and Senior—and contains 30 questions that become progressively more challenging. Students receive a score, an award outcome and a performance certificate showing how they performed across different areas of mathematics.

  • The AMC gives students an opportunity to:

    • apply classroom mathematics to unfamiliar and engaging problems;

    • strengthen logical reasoning, mathematical interpretation and problem-solving skills;

    • experience an internationally recognised mathematics competition;

    • challenge themselves at a level appropriate to their school year;

    • receive an external benchmark against students in the same year level and region;

    • identify areas of mathematical strength and opportunities for further development;

    • gain recognition through certificates, awards and special distinctions; and

    • explore whether they are ready for more advanced mathematics enrichment or Olympiad-style opportunities.


    The problems become progressively more difficult, allowing a broad range of students to engage with the early questions while providing substantial extension for strong problem solvers.

  • The AMC is suitable for students who:

    • enjoy mathematics, puzzles, patterns or logical challenges;

    • want to apply school mathematics beyond routine exercises;

    • would like to assess their mathematical problem-solving ability;

    • are participating in an academic competition for the first time;

    • want a structured challenge without beginning directly at Olympiad level;

    • are looking for extension beyond the standard classroom programme; or

    • may be ready to explore more advanced AMT competitions in the future.


    It is not limited to experienced competition students. Because the paper increases in difficulty, students with different levels of confidence can attempt meaningful questions while stronger students are extended by the later problems.

  • Students do not need intensive Olympiad training to participate successfully in the AMC. Preparation should focus on understanding the format, strengthening core mathematics and becoming comfortable with unfamiliar problem-solving situations.

    Recommended preparation includes:

    • reviewing the main mathematics topics appropriate to the student’s division;

    • attempting official AMC sample problems;

    • practising previous AMC questions at the correct division level;

    • studying worked solutions and comparing different solution methods;

    • practising without a calculator where calculators are not permitted;

    • developing systematic strategies for diagrams, patterns and counting problems;

    • completing some practice sets under timed conditions;

    • learning to skip a difficult question temporarily and return to it later;

    • checking integer answers carefully before submitting them; and

    • attempting every question, as incorrect answers do not attract a penalty.

    The Australian Maths Trust provides official sample sets for each division, with six previous AMC problems and worked solutions. Past-paper packs and additional problem-solving resources are also available.

  • The AMC consists of 30 questions:

    • 25 multiple-choice questions

    • 5 questions requiring an integer answer


    Primary Divisions

    Middle Primary and Upper Primary students have 60 minutes.


    Secondary Divisions

    Junior, Intermediate and Senior students have 75 minutes.


    Scoring

    • Questions 1–10: 3 marks each

    • Questions 11–20: 4 marks each

    • Questions 21–25: 5 marks each

    • Questions 26–30: 6, 7, 8, 9 and 10 marks respectively

    • Maximum score: 135 marks


    There is no penalty for an incorrect answer, so students are encouraged to attempt every question.


    The official competition may be delivered online or as a printed paper. The delivery option available to New Zealand students should be confirmed through the current competition opportunity.


    Pocket or scientific calculators are permitted only in the Middle Primary and Upper Primary divisions. Calculators are not permitted in the Junior, Intermediate or Senior divisions. Printed language dictionaries or approved readers may be used in all divisions.

  • Every participating student receives an award outcome and an electronic certificate. AMC participants also receive a hard-copy performance certificate. The certificate records the student’s result and provides information about their performance.


    Participation

    Awarded to a student who participates and does not receive a higher award.


    Proficiency

    Awarded to a student who reaches a preset score and receives no higher award. This recognises competency in mathematical problem solving against Australian standards.


    Credit

    Awarded to students in approximately the top 55% of their year level and region, or the top 60% in the Senior division, who receive no higher award.


    Distinction

    Awarded to students in approximately the top 20% of their year level and region, or the top 25% in the Senior division, who receive no higher award.


    High Distinction

    Awarded to students in approximately the top 3% of their year level and region, or the top 5% in the Senior division, who receive no higher award.


    Prize

    Generally awarded to no more than one student in every 300 students within a region and year group.


    Best in School

    Awarded to the strongest eligible result within a school, after adjustment for year level. Minimum entry and achievement conditions apply.


    Peter O’Halloran Award

    Awarded to any student who achieves a perfect score.


    Additional recognition may include AMC Medals and the Cheryl Praeger Medal, subject to the applicable criteria.


    Award cut-off scores are determined by comparing students with others in the same year level and region, such as an Australian state or territory or an individual country. Cut-offs vary from year to year depending on the difficulty of the paper and overall performance.

  • The AMC is a broad-entry mathematics competition and does not itself represent direct entry into the Australian Maths Trust’s Olympiad pathway.


    However, a very strong AMC result may indicate that a student is ready for more advanced mathematical problem solving. Students in suitable year levels may consider the Australian Intermediate Mathematics Olympiad (AIMO), a substantially more demanding competition that includes integer-answer questions and written mathematical solutions.


    The Australian Maths Trust identifies students for its formal Olympiad pathway primarily through more advanced competitions and programmes. AIMO is specifically described as suitable for students who have scored very highly in the AMC, and AIMO results may be used to identify students for the AMT Olympiad pathway.


    Entry into any subsequent competition, programme or selection pathway is separate and is not automatic following AMC participation or an AMC award.
